Transaction 4059e7f691b44c90c105647503065869492d02850b03e8235fb0c805f278741f
1 Input
2 Outputs
- 4059e7f691b44c90c105647503065869492d02850b03e8235fb0c805f278741f:0
- 4059e7f691b44c90c105647503065869492d02850b03e8235fb0c805f278741f:1
value 1283891
address 1NekTEGXEnrSvSLekki4xCGrTVUz4YQfyC
value 7827163
address 16UgwLpcT6gSZ1xkCPVCddpmEp4Kty7Jye